While these exercises provided a basic measure of physical fitness, they did not adequately reflect the physical challenges soldiers face in combat situations. The ACFT was developed to replace the Army Physical Fitness Test (APFT), which had been in use since the 1980s. The ACFT was created to address this gap by incorporating a more diverse range of exercises that simulate the physical demands of combat. The APFT primarily focused on three events: push-ups, sit-ups, and a two-mile run.

The transition from the APFT to the ACFT has been met with mixed reactions among soldiers and leadership. Proponents argue that the ACFT provides a more comprehensive assessment of fitness, aligning better with the physical demands of modern military operations. The events included in the ACFT are believed to better prepare soldiers for the rigors of combat, as they emphasize functional strength and endurance over the traditional focus on running and sit-ups.

Leg Tuck: This event tests core strength and grip by requiring soldiers to hang from a pull-up bar and tuck their knees to their chest. The number of successful repetitions completed determines the score.
